
Introduction:
Hormones are called chemical messengers. With the help of blood, the hormones reach to the organs and the tissue to maintain their function. There are many types of hormones that are secreted in the body to maintain the processes and function. Thyroxine hormone is secreted by thyroid glands. Among these, epinephrine hormone is released by the adrenal gland and it is produced in high amounts during chronic stress, tumors, and obesity. The result of excessive production of epinephrine is sweating, irregular and rapid heartbeat, and anxiety.
